Having identified where AI might fit in your business (Lesson 1), the next step is turning those opportunities into a structured plan. An AI strategy doesn't need to be a 50-page document. It needs to be clear, honest, and actionable — a roadmap that connects your business goals to specific AI initiatives, with realistic timelines and accountability.
This lesson walks you through building that strategy, step by step.
It's tempting to skip the strategy and jump straight to implementation. A team member finds a promising AI tool, runs a proof of concept, and suddenly you have an "AI initiative." The problem is that scattered experiments rarely compound. You end up with disconnected tools, duplicated effort, and no clear picture of return on investment.
